Job Description:

 

As the IT Specialist – Endpoints, you will play a critical role in shaping and delivering endpoint services across the organisation. Reporting to the IT Manager – Endpoints, you will help define standards, drive service improvements, and provide expert-level support for complex endpoint environments. You will lead transformative projects, champion operational excellence, and ensure our endpoint infrastructure remains secure, modern, and optimised. 

 

Success in this role requires deep collaboration across infrastructure, service delivery, applications, and security teams. You will align operational activities with strategic goals, contribute to digital transformation initiatives, and help create a seamless experience for colleagues. Your expertise will be instrumental in enhancing operational resilience and supporting innovation across the organisation. 

 

We are committed to building a diverse, inclusive, and high-performing IT function. In this role, you will help nurture talent, drive innovation, and create an environment where people feel supported, empowered, and valued in their mission to deliver outstanding endpoint services. 

 

Key Responsibilities 

 

Endpoint Service Leadership 

  • Act as the technical authority for endpoint services, providing expert guidance on standards, strategy, and best practices. 

  • Deliver advanced 4th line support and problem management for endpoint infrastructure, ensuring systems are current, secure, and optimised. 

  • Serve as an escalation point for complex incidents and changes, driving timely resolution and continuous improvement. 

  • Lead and contribute to projects involving modern management solutions, automation, and service enhancements. 

  • Implement and optimise Microsoft endpoint technologies, including Intune, SCCM, and Defender for Endpoints.
